How Progressive Web Apps Work
Progressive Web Apps combine modern browser technologies with mobile-friendly experiences.
Core Technologies Behind PWAs
Service Workers
Enable:
- Offline caching
- Faster loading
- Background sync
- Push notifications
Responsive UI Frameworks
PWAs adapt across:
- Smartphones
- Tablets
- Desktops
HTTPS Security
Secure protocols protect:
- User data
- Authentication
- Transactions
Web App Manifest
Allows:
- Home screen installation
- App-like appearance
- Full-screen mode

PWA vs Mobile Apps: Cost Breakdown in 2026
Progressive Web App Costs
Project Type |
Estimated Cost |
| Basic PWA | $8,000–$20,000 |
| Medium Complexity | $20,000–$50,000 |
| Enterprise PWA | $50,000–$120,000 |
PWAs lower costs through:
- Single codebase
- Faster deployment
- Reduced maintenance
Native Mobile App Costs
| Project Type | Estimated Cost |
| Basic App | $20,000–$50,000 |
| Mid-Level App | $50,000–$120,000 |
| Enterprise App | $120,000–$300,000+ |
Native apps cost more because businesses often build:
- Separate iOS apps
- Separate Android apps
- Dedicated backend systems

Frequently Asked Questions (FAQs)
Is a PWA better than a mobile app?
PWAs are better for affordability, SEO visibility, and fast deployment. Native mobile apps are better for performance, engagement, and advanced device functionality. The best choice depends on your business objectives and user expectations.
Are PWAs cheaper than native apps?
Yes. PWAs usually cost significantly less because developers maintain one codebase instead of separate iOS and Android applications.
Can a PWA replace a native mobile app?
In some industries, yes. However, apps requiring advanced hardware integrations, gaming features, or premium performance still benefit from native development.
Which industries benefit most from PWAs?
SaaS platforms, media companies, educational businesses, and marketplaces often gain strong ROI from Progressive Web Apps.
Are native apps more secure than PWAs?
Native apps generally provide stronger security capabilities because they integrate deeply with operating system-level protections and authentication systems.
